Exegetical and Hermeneutical Commentary of 1 Chronicles 26:22
The sons of Jehieli; Zetham, and Joel his brother, [which were] over the treasures of the house of the LORD. 22. Zetham and Joel ] These appear rather as brethren of Jehieli (Jehiel) in 1Ch 23:8; but since families, not individuals, are spoken of, the discrepancy is not important.
